Market Analysis
In New York, 71 schools offer Computer and Information Sciences, General degrees. Graduates earn an average of $68,158.41 one year after graduation. This is slightly less than the national median of $68,453.81 for this major.
The data does not provide information on the job market outlook for this major in New York. However, the average earnings for graduates in New York are very close to the national median, suggesting the degree holds similar value in the state compared to the rest of the country.
